Caraway is a biennial herb grown for its distinctive crescent-shaped seeds used in rye bread, sauerkraut, and European cuisine. The leaves and roots are also edible.
West Feliciana Parish, Louisiana is in USDA Zone 9a. The average last spring frost is February 21 and the first fall frost is November 26, giving you a growing season of approximately 278 days.
At an elevation of 225 feet, West Feliciana Parish receives approximately 60.1 inches of rainfall annually with predominantly sandy loam soil. Summer highs average 96°F, so Caraway may need afternoon shade and extra watering during peak heat. Sandy soil warms quickly in spring — great for early planting — but Caraway will need more frequent watering and organic matter to retain nutrients. Ample rainfall means less supplemental watering, but ensure good drainage to prevent Caraway root diseases.

Soil Compatibility in West Feliciana Parish
How your county's soil matches Caraway's growing requirements.
Soil pH
Your soil pH (5.1–6.2) is more acidic than Caraway prefers (6.0–7.5). Add garden lime to raise pH.
Soil Texture
Sandy soil in West Feliciana Parish warms quickly in spring but drains fast. Caraway will need more frequent watering and regular compost additions to retain nutrients.
Drainage
Drainage is adequate for Caraway.
Organic Matter
Organic matter is moderate (2.3%). Annual compost additions will help Caraway.

Growing Tips for Caraway in West Feliciana Parish
Direct sow Caraway outdoors after February 21 in West Feliciana Parish when soil has warmed and frost danger has passed.
Sandy soil in West Feliciana Parish dries quickly — mulch Caraway with 2-3 inches of straw and water deeply 2-3 times per week rather than lightly every day.
With summer highs reaching 96°F in West Feliciana Parish, provide afternoon shade for Caraway and water deeply in the morning.
Your 279.0-day growing season in West Feliciana Parish is tight for Caraway (365.0-450.0 days to maturity). Start indoors and choose early-maturing varieties.
Common pests for Caraway in this region include carrot rust fly and parsleyworm. Use row covers early in the season and inspect plants weekly.
General growing tips
Direct sow in spring or fall. Caraway produces seeds in its second year. Harvest seed heads when they turn brown. The young leaves can be used like parsley.
